### Step 5: Enable soft deletes on orders

After this migration, Cartenby stops hard-deleting orders; rows get a deleted-at stamp instead. Support team: this means "deleted" orders are still findable in the admin view with the trash filter on, which should cut down on escalations about vanished order history. Restores are now one click. The orders service picks up this behavior from the settings below:

deployment values, yadug-bawif:
[framir]
team = pelox
access_code = ac_a38ab2
owner = tamion.julael
host = framir.tolvaqlabs.test
port = 11211
peer = tammir.zemvargrid.local
salt = 2215ef03
pin = 1541

Subject: Key rotation — Pinwheel registry access

Team,

As part of the new dependency pinning policy, all builds must resolve packages through the Pinwheel internal registry using pinned lockfiles. The previous registry key is revoked effective Friday. CI pipelines and local tooling must be updated before then; unpinned resolution will fail closed. Audit notes are in the Greywater review folder. The replacement key for the registry service is below.

gateway credential: kto23_LX9A4ys6i4nzHtpOLNLodKK

**Action Item 2: Tame the spreadsheet export memory hog**

Big exports in LedgerLoom were loading every row into memory at once, which is why support kept seeing timeouts on large accounts. We're switching to streamed writes next sprint. Until then, tell customers to export in chunks. The workaround steps are documented here:

runbook for badug-kadup: https://confluence.zemvarlabs.internal/projects/browse/display/projects/bd1b

Subject: Annual DR drill — WashVault locker access flow

Future maintainers: this documents our yearly disaster-recovery drill for the WashVault laundry-locker access flow. We simulate a full outage of the primary door-release service and restore from the Kellamy mirror. Please record timings carefully for the postmortem. Should the restore console demand credentials, the recovery passphrase is kept directly below.

unlock words, hahip-baduf: holwyn-istath-julvan